Introduction

Fortschritt ZT 320: Agricultural Tractor Reference

The Fortschritt ZT 320 is a two-wheel-drive agricultural tractor manufactured in Schönebeck, Germany, between 1984 and 1990. This machine was designed to serve as a primary power source for mid-to-large scale farming operations during the late 20th century.

Engine and Performance

The tractor is powered by a 4-cylinder, liquid-cooled diesel engine with a displacement of 6.6 liters (400.3 cubic inches). It delivers a rated power output of 98.6 hp (73.5 kW) at an engine speed of 1800 RPM. The engine is characterized by a peak torque of 317.2 lb-ft (430.1 Nm), reached at 1350 RPM, which provides consistent pulling capability under load.

Transmission and Drivetrain

Equipped with a mechanical transmission system, the ZT 320 offers 9 forward gears and 6 reverse gears, allowing for a range of speeds suitable for field work and transport. The power is delivered to the rear wheels via a 2WD configuration.

Hydraulics and PTO

The machine features a rear Power Take-Off (PTO) system capable of operating at 540 and 1000 RPM, ensuring compatibility with a variety of implements. The rear hitch is categorized as Type II, providing standard connection points for heavy agricultural attachments.

Dimensions and Specifications

The tractor measures 185.4 inches (470 cm) in length and has a base operating weight of 10,760 lbs (4880 kg). It is fitted with 10-20 front agricultural tires and 18.4-34 rear agricultural tires, which contribute to the machine's overall stability and traction on varied soil conditions.

Production Information of Fortschritt, ZT 320

  • Built in Schönebeck, Saxony-Anhalt, Germany
ManufacturerFortschritt

Dimension and Tires Information of Fortschritt, ZT 320

Length185.4 inches [470 cm]
Weight10,760 lbs [4880 kg]
Ag front10-20
Ag rear18.4-34

Engine Specifications of Fortschritt, ZT 320

  • VEB
  • Liquid-cooled
  • Diesel
  • 4-cylinder
Firing order1-3-4-2
Displacement400.3 ci [6.6 L]
Rated RPM1800
Bore/Stroke4.724x5.709 inches [120 x 145 mm]
Torque RPM1350
Torque317.2 lb-ft [430.1 Nm]
Power98.6 hp [73.5 kW]

Transmission Information of Fortschritt, ZT 320

Transmission variants 1

Gears9 forward and 6 reverse

Mechanical Specs of Fortschritt, ZT 320

Drive2WD

Power Information of Fortschritt, ZT 320

Rear PTO Type540/1000

Three-Point Hitch of Fortschritt, ZT 320

Rear TypeII

Where it sits

With 98 HP, the Fortschritt ZT 320 sits between R-S 03 (30 HP) and ZT 423 (140 HP) in Fortschritt's range. Its power puts it in the 70th percentile of 1980s models in our database (2052 machines).
